Output 9964a828499e9a24718249d856b12fe8d588512a37069e180db75fb884b173f4:0

value
639019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ddbf4ee651711b08fae6ba51c915f4c632942765 OP_EQUAL
address
3MuWSGLJ6YqND8xQ6WWPLZohMjGAPW6aup
transaction
9964a828499e9a24718249d856b12fe8d588512a37069e180db75fb884b173f4
spent
true